    SAINT MAX AND THE FANATICS
    Debut EP released Monday 16th July 2012
    CD / DIGITAL DOWNLOAD

    At the eye of the storm: Saint Max.

    An adolescence spent in the depths of the South West Scottish countryside has left this particular prophet with countless songbooks bulging with wry observation, uncommon passion and pop melodies which refuse to be shaken off. The sound is undeniably contemporary, with sprinklings of artful nostalgia.

    2012 sees this wandering poet’s dramatic entrance to the scene: with the release of his debut EP “Saint Max and the Fanatics”, recorded at Glasgow’s all-analogue Green Door Studio. Harking back to luminaries as varied as Bowie, Madness and Morrissey, Saint Max’s sound is born to an eclectic family of influences. It is bound together, however, by a razor sharp delivery which simply cannot be ignored.

    As the headlines above show, Saint Max’s brand of offbeat-pop is already winning the attention of respected Scottish bloggers, Saint Max is determined to have the last word – and he wants to make sure you’re listening.
